Hi Y'all,

I did a ``make release'' on the 23rd of this month.  Another on
the 27th. Both built fine.

The 23rd panicked during installation.  Something strange.  
Since the kernel of later that day did NOT panic, I decided to
build again, on the 27th.

This release installs fine (I am using ftp install in both cases).

The Problem:

The display for the fdisk functionality displays in a garbled
manner.  It appears as if most of the cursor motion commands are
missing, but not all.  If the text wants highlighted, (white on
blue), it appears almost correct.

The disklabel screen is better but still garbled.


Another, old Problem:

The disklabel screen, if you have more than few partitions, you
do not see some of the defined entries.  It behaves as if the
entries are there, but ``hiding undeneath'' instructions at the
bottom.  Very annoying for large, complex installations.  We have
at least 18 partitions in the standard install.  Typically more.
